Budd Lake Assists Bernardsville Fire

This past week firefighters were dispatched for there Tender (57) to respond to Post Kennel Rd. to assist with water supply. Upon arrival the crew shuttled water from the fill site to the fire at least 5 times and when the fire was out they also assisted with filling a underground cistern. The truck returned … Read more

Range Rover Burns on Rt. 80 in Budd Lake

Early Monday morning at 2 am Budd Lake Fire responded to Rt. 80 West mm 24.2 for a car fire Chief 51 and 52 arrived and reported a range rover fully involved in fire. Engine 59 arrived and stretched a front bumper line on the fire they also had to deploy a dry chemical extinguisher … Read more

Ladder Company Rescues 2 from Bucket

Two workers were changing lights on a light pole at the Union Stanhope Cemetery when there boom truck became disabled leaving them stuck 25 to 30 feet up in the air. Ladder 58 and Chief 1, 2 & 3 placed the aerial ladder next to the basket and removed the two workers who were stuck … Read more
